#173105 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#173105 is composed of 9% red, 19.2%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 89.8% yellow and 80.8% black. It has a hue angle of 95.5 degrees, a saturation of 81.5% and a lightness of 10.6%. #173105 color hex could be obtained by blending #2e620a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

● #173105 color description : Very dark (mostly black) green.
#173105 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#173105 has RGB values of R:23, G:49,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0.53, M:0, Y:0.9,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 1519877.
